NotionFlare plans scale from a public Notion site to a Knowledge Base your groups can /ask. Live limits are on Pricing.

What does Free include?

  • Publish from Notion to your public site (Title, Slug, Status, body).
  • Personal Knowledge Base for private + public posts (up to ~30 posts in your Knowledge Base at once).
  • Dashboard Try /ask (10/day · 100/month) against your own Knowledge Base (including private posts you own).
  • Telegram / Discord / Slack `/ask` on linked groups — Public corpus only (inquiry / lead FAQs). Shared ask quota with Dashboard.
  • Optional: turn on platform discovery so public posts can join the official Telegram demo corpus (see Platform discovery).
  • Not included: Private (or Private+Public) IM corpus, image text, AI auto-cover.

What do Pro and Business add?

  • Higher sync and Knowledge Base caps (Pro ~1000 posts, Business ~3000). Caps are concurrent slots — archived / removed posts free capacity; updating a post you already keep does not consume a new slot.
  • Per-group Ask corpus: Public, Private, or Private + Public — e.g. member groups on Private, inquiry chats on Public.
  • Higher Ask quotas (shared by Dashboard + IM channels). Ask is the main usage gate.
  • Image text (opt-in) — separate quota from /ask.
  • Media hosting & uploads — for images and assets on the site.
  • AI auto-cover (Business only) when a post has no cover image — separate day/month quota (~10/day · 150/mo). Pro does not include auto-cover; use a Notion cover or Featured Image instead.
  • Audience topics (Business only) — semantic clusters of similar /ask questions on Home (Pro still gets helpful rate, emoji mood, and exact “most asked”). Feedback setup: Ask feedback channels.

Business is aimed at larger communities (Telegram, Discord, or Slack — roughly 1k–10k members) with higher daily and monthly /ask and image-text limits, plus more storage.

Why isn’t AI auto-cover on Pro?

Auto-cover is an extra paid image generation step and is not part of the core “Notion → site + /ask” path. Pro focuses quota on Ask and Knowledge Base size. Prefer a Notion page cover or Featured Image — that uses no AI cover quota. Business keeps a metered auto-cover allowance for larger publishing volume.

How do /ask quotas work?

  • Quotas are per account owner, shared by Dashboard Try /ask, Command-K Ask, and everyone in linked IM groups.
  • Limits are daily and monthly and scale by plan (Free includes a small shared quota).
  • Unused day or month allowance does not roll over to the next period.
  • Brief rate limits also apply (anti-abuse); hitting either the burst or the day/month cap blocks asks.
  • Direct messages with the bot do not run Knowledge Base /ask — use a linked group.

What happens if I downgrade to Free?

  • IM Ask corpus is hard-locked to Public again — private/draft pages stop answering in linked groups even if the dashboard still shows an old Private setting.
  • Ask quotas, Knowledge Base post caps, image text, and AI auto-cover drop to Free limits (live numbers on Pricing).
  • Your Notion connection and public site keep working within Free publishing rules.
  • Stripe cancels usually stay paid until the period end, then drop to Free (see Billing below).

Private vs public Status?

  • private — Knowledge Base only; not on the public blog or Command-K Search. Exposed in IM only when the linked group’s corpus includes Private (Pro+).
  • public — On your site; can opt into platform discovery for the official demo. Usable on Free IM groups.

Where do I upgrade?

Open Pricing or Dashboard → Billing for Pro (Stripe Checkout). Business checkout is intentionally delayed — the card shows limits for planning, but Subscribe stays Coming soon until we open that tier.

How do I cancel or manage billing?

  1. Use Manage billing for the Stripe Customer Portal (invoices, payment method, receipts).
  2. Or cancel from the same page — when a Stripe subscription exists, cancel is usually at period end; you keep Pro until then, then Free rules apply (including Public-only IM).

App Store / Play subscriptions must be cancelled in the store; deleting a NotionFlare account does not cancel those stores for you.

Is AI Studio included?

No. AI Studio and Telegram /image generation have been discontinued. Business may still auto-generate a cover image for posts that have no cover, within a separate day/month quota. Plans otherwise focus on Knowledge Base /ask, image text (opt-in on paid), media storage, and optional social distribution.
